# Catalogue Import — Environments

The Bramblehurst catalogue importer runs in three environments: sandbox, staging, and production. Sandbox points at a synthetic MARC feed and may be reset at will. Staging mirrors the live branch catalogue nightly, so record counts should track production within a day. Production imports run at 02:00 local and must never overlap the circulation backup. Before promoting a release, the release manager should confirm staging matches these configuration values.

config for kajog-tadug:
[casax]
port = 11211
region = west-3
host = casax.nelvroworks.internal
timeout_ms = 5000
retries = 7

**Action Item 4 (owner: platform team, due next sprint):** Audit the Wrenfold template renderer for unbounded partial recursion, which caused the latency spike during the incident and could be triggered deliberately with crafted templates. Add depth limits and per-render CPU budgets. The renderer's threat assessment and benchmark results are on the internal page below.

operations page: https://jenkins.zemvarcloud.local/job/merge_requests/repo/build/73930b4b30f0a8ed

## Who to Contact: Log Sampling for Chirpgate

Chirpgate emits roughly forty log lines per request, so the platform team enforces adaptive sampling at the ingest tier. Plugin authors should not disable sampling from inside a plugin — your debug lines will be dropped anyway, and you may trip the noise quota for everyone sharing your namespace. Instead, request a temporary sampling exemption scoped to your plugin ID, which the observability crew can grant for up to seven days. Send exemption requests to the address below.

escalation mailbox, bafog-fafog: ulador@paliqlabs.internal

## Replica Lag Alarm

The Ferngate alarm fires when read-replica lag on the orders cluster exceeds 30 seconds for five consecutive checks. First, confirm the primary is healthy and check for long-running transactions. If lag persists, drain the replica from the pool via the Relayer admin endpoint, which authenticates with the key below.

API key for kahop-bagef: zpat2_yb